Energetic Creature Lover

Pet care experience

There's nothing better then being able to explore the world while out on a walk with a four-legged companion and there is no better company then that of a dog. I've grown up with dogs of all shapes and sizes all my life--from energetic Malamute Huskies to shy Dachshunds, each one has played a pivotal part in who I am. I have several years experience with horses, reptiles, amphibians, and birds and have loved everyone of them. I am a patient person who will take the time to get to know your pup and your creatures so that all their needs are met. I live a very active, outdoor oriented life style and currently work as a Wildlife biologist with Oregon Fish and Wildlife. My seasonal work has come to a close so my schedule tends to vary a bit but I am very flexible when it comes to hours or working with your schedule. While attending UC Davis I worked with the Equestrian Vet Hospital and am no stranger to hard work or fast paced situations, your pup will be in capable and loving hands.
